This book is an autobiography of the author's life. It is written from memories of a bygone era. A story of growing up in Appalachia during the Depression.
Intertwined with the harshness of the times were humor, joy, and always love. The book captures the spirit, the customs, and the traditions of the magnificent, ordinary people who lived during that time.
The beauty of nature comes alive from the hills, valleys and streams. You can hear the strains of the mountain music, and feel your heart warmed by the faith of the mountain people.

Autoren-Porträt von Justine Felix Rutherford
Justine Rutherford grew up on a farm in Spurlock Creek, West Virginia. After a marvelous childhood, she went to high school at Milton, and attended Marshall University in Huntington, becoming a nurse in 1962 and retiring from St. Mary's Hospital in 1986. She has two sons, seven grandchildren and seven great-grandchildren.
